Mumbai, March 11 -- The average of household spending in Japan was up 0.8 percent on year in January, the Ministry of Internal Affairs and Communications said on Tuesday - coming in at 305,521 yen.
On a monthly basis, household spending slumped 4.5 percent - agan missing forecasts for a decline of 1.9 percent after rising 2.3 percent in the previous month.
The average of monthly income per household stood at 514,877 yen, down 1.1 percent from the previous year.
